2022 in NASCAR. In 2022 NASCAR will sanction three national series: 2022 NASCAR Cup Series – the top racing series in NASCAR. 2022 NASCAR Xfinity Series – the second-highest racing series in NASCAR. 2022 NASCAR Camping World Truck Series – the third-highest racing series in NASCAR. The National Association for Stock Car Auto Racing (NASCAR) is the largest stock car racing sanctioning body in the United States. The three largest racing series sanctioned by NASCAR are the Cup Series, the Xfinity Series and the Craftsman Truck Series. The 2023 NASCAR Cup Series was the 75th season for NASCAR professional stock car racing in the United States and the 52nd season for the modern-era Cup Series. 1996 Winston Cup champion Terry Labonte. The 1996 NASCAR Winston Cup Series consisted of 31 events, run at 18 race tracks in 15 states. Terry Labonte won his second series championship, beating Jeff Gordon by 37 points; the Rick Hendrick-owned No. 5 Kellogg's Corn Flakes Chevrolet team won the series' owner's championship. The Busch Light Clash is an annual non-championship pre-season NASCAR Cup Series exhibition event held in February before the season-opening Daytona 500. The event was held each year at Daytona International Speedway from the race's inception in 1979 until 2021, after which it was moved to the Los Angeles Memorial Coliseum beginning in 2022.

Dec 29, 2008 · NASCAR places strict limits, for instance, on how engine cylinders are bored -- that is, how they're made larger by removing material. NASCAR also requires teams to use blocks, cylinders and intake manifolds made from castings of approved manufacturers.
